WEST AUSTRALIA
UPPER HOUSE AMENDS ADDRESS-IN-REPLY. PERTH, July 19. The Legislative Council by 16 votes to 6, carried an amendment to the Address-in-Reply, condemning the Government for expending money unconstitutionally without Parliamentary authority, and ignoring the Council’s right by assuming that the only ratification required was the Assembly vote. The Council then, by 10 votes to 7, passed the amended Address.
